Output 2c916959c08c6aecb29da0973da4d02578906524ceae284447ae09b4558ba8a4:7

value
2296257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8e7b41fea0cd224405776ea048c85873dcb55c8 OP_EQUAL
address
3MTuT2bX9yWWWu5G6uss7VpYCMV2B3ZCmC
transaction
2c916959c08c6aecb29da0973da4d02578906524ceae284447ae09b4558ba8a4
spent
true